‘Afif b Qays said
“I was sitting with al- Abbas b. ‘Abd al-Muttalib, may God be
pleased with him, in Mecca, before the affairs of the Prophet
(PBUH) became known to the public. A man came and looked up
toward the sky where the sun hovered above. He turned in the
direction of the Ka’bah and stood to pray. Then a youth came and
stood at his right and a woman came and stood behind them both.
The man bowed, and the youth and the woman bowed. The man
raised his hands and the youth and the woman raised their hands.
Then he prostrated and they both prostrated.
“Abbas!” I exclaimed, “it is a fantastic affair” “Indeed, it is a
fantastic affair,” replied al-Abbas. “Do you know who that man is?
He is Muhammad b. Abd’Allah, my cousin. Do you know who
that youth is? He is Ali b. Abi Talib, my cousin. Do you know who
that woman is? She is Khadija daughter of Khuwaylid _ _.”
Kitab al-Irshad p 18

Among the earliest converts to Islam were Yasir; his wife


Sumayya and their son Ammar. They were the first family all
members of which accepted Islam simultaneously.
In the sight of the Quran , the most exalted person is the
muttaqi - that is one who loves and obeys God. The Quraysh
were not receptive of such ideas. They considered them as rank
blasphemy.
The Quraysh opened the campaign agaisnt Islam by harrassing
and presecuting the Muslims. As time went on they started
doing violent deeds.
Yasir and his family had no tribal affiliation in Makkah. In
Makkah they were foreigners and there was none to protect
them. All three were savagely tortured by Abu Jahl and other
infedels. Sumayya died while being tortured and became the
first martyr in Islam and Yasir became the second.
Restatement of History of Islam p 50-54

Conquest of Makkah

When the Prophet (PBUH) wanted to conquer Makkah, he


asked God, may His name be exalted, to keep the reports
of it hidden from the Quraysh so that he could enter it
unexpectedly. However, Hatib b. Abi Balta’a wrote to the
Meccans to inform them of the decision of the Prophet
(PBUH). He gave the letter to a black woman and told her
to take the back road to deliver it in secrecy to Makkah.
The Prophet (PBUH) summoned the Commander of the
faithful (PBUH) and instructed him to bring the letter from
the woman. Then he summoned al-Zubayr b al-Awwam
and told him to go with Ali b. Abi Talib on this mission.
When they caught up with the woman al-Zubayr was
unable to get the letter from her.
Imam Ali (AS) drew his sword and advanced toward her
threatening to cut off her head. She gave him the letter.
Kitab al-Irshad p 36
Taif

The Prophet (PBUH) went to Taif more than ten years after he had
first begun to preach Islam. In Ta’if he called on three chiefs of the
local tribes to abandon idolatory and accept Islam. In return Zayd and
the Prophet (PBUH) were pelted with stones. He turned around and
went back to Makkah. At this time Abu Talib was no more and Pagan
hostility was at its peak.
Mutim ibn Adiy - a pagan chief responded to the call of the Prophet. It
was the same Mutim who had torn the covenant of boycott of the
Quraysh. His tribe marched in full battle gear out of the city and
brought the Prophet (PBUH) to the precints of the Kaaba. Here he
continued his Mission. He visited the nearby hamlets and propagated
the Message of Islam. The Quraysh too shadowed him during these
trips and used to interrupt the meetings calling him a madcap. The
Prophet (a.s) however maintained his calm and composure. He never
reacted angrily and thus continued his mission.
Pilgrims from Yathrib

It was the practice of the Prophet (a.s) that during the Hajj, he used to
meet the persons coming from far away places to give them the
Message of Islam. It was the Hajj on the tenth year after the
Annunciation when a group from Yathrib visited Makkah. When the
Prophet (a.s) during a trip of propagation reached Mina, he came
across six persons near `Uqbah. He went near them and asked about
the tribe to which they belonged. They said that they were from Yathrib
and they belonged to the Tribe of Khazraj. The Prophet (a.s) sat down
with that group and recited to them some Verses from the Holy Qur’an
and invited them to embrace Islam. They were much influenced by the
Islamic Principles and they readily embraced it. Now, this was the
beginning of the spread of Islam in Yathrib. During the next Hajj,
twelve persons came from Yathrib and embraced Islam. The following
year a contingent of seventy-three persons arrived and embraced
Islam at the hands of the Prophet (a.s) these persons said that it was
their desire that the Prophet (a.s) changed his residence to Yathrib and
made it the head quarters for his Mission.
